The Heir Summary of Kiera Cass's Book

The Heir by Kiera Cass: A Captivating Tale of Love and Empowerment
Kiera Cass's novel, The Heir, invites readers back into the captivating world of Illea, where love, power, and sacrifice intertwine to create a mesmerizing tale. First published on May 5, 2015, the book belongs to the genres of Romance, Young Adult, and Dystopia, making it a must-read for fans of these genres. As the fourth installment in The Selection series, The Heir introduces readers to Princess Eadlyn, a strong and independent young woman who must navigate the complexities of love and duty in a world filled with expectations.

Detailed Summary
In The Heir, readers are introduced to Princess Eadlyn, the daughter of America Singer and Prince Maxon, who must now oversee her own Selection to find a suitable partner. Despite her initial reluctance to participate in the Selection, Eadlyn finds herself drawn to several of the contestants, including Kile Woodwork and Hale Garner, as she grapples with her feelings and the expectations placed upon her.
As the competition unfolds, Eadlyn must confront her own beliefs about love and duty, grappling with the complexities of her position as the future queen of Illea.
